centos ulimit怎样调整系统日志记录限制
在 CentOS 系统中,你可以使用 ulimit
命令来调整系统日志记录的限制。以下是一些常见的方法:
1. 临时调整当前会话的 ulimit
如果你只想在当前会话中调整 ulimit
,可以使用以下命令:
ulimit -n
例如,将文件描述符的最大数量设置为 65535:
ulimit -n 65535
2. 永久调整 ulimit
如果你想永久调整 ulimit
,需要编辑系统配置文件。以下是一些常见的配置文件:
a. /etc/security/limits.conf
编辑 /etc/security/limits.conf
文件,添加或修改以下行:
* soft nofile
* hard nofile
例如,将所有用户的文件描述符最大数量设置为 65535:
* soft nofile 65535
* hard nofile 65535
b. /etc/pam.d/common-session
确保 /etc/pam.d/common-session
文件中包含以下行:
session required pam_limits.so
c. /etc/pam.d/common-session-noninteractive
确保 /etc/pam.d/common-session-noninteractive
文件中也包含以下行:
session required pam_limits.so
d. 重启服务
修改配置文件后,需要重启相关服务以使更改生效。例如,如果你调整的是系统日志记录服务的限制,可能需要重启 rsyslog
或 syslog-ng
服务:
sudo systemctl restart rsyslog
或
sudo systemctl restart syslog-ng
3. 检查 ulimit
设置
你可以使用以下命令检查当前的 ulimit
设置:
ulimit -a
这将显示所有当前的 ulimit
设置,包括文件描述符的最大数量。
通过以上步骤,你应该能够成功调整 CentOS 系统日志记录的限制。
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权请联系我们,一经查实立即删除!